Thousands of low-cost used and new political and historical books and pamphlets will be available at a one-day-only book sale in South Los Angeles. As independent book stores are closing down daily and increasingly fewer public outlets are available that carry materials outside of the mainstream, the sale will provide access to hard-to-find books on current and historical political conditions. Books will be available on politics, history, ethnic studies, and more, and an exhibit of artwork by prisoners in the Security Housing Unit at Pelican Bay State Prison will be on display. The book sale will take place at the Southern California Library, located at 6120 S. Vermont Avenue, Los Angeles (between Slauson and Gage) on Saturday, May 12, 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. The event is free and open to the public; families and children welcome. Refreshments will be offered.
